### Imports ###
import functools
import logging
import sys
import types
### Logger ###
class KiiFormatter(logging.Formatter):
'''
Conditional formatter used for logger.
'''
FORMATS = {
logging.ERROR: '\033[5;1;31mERROR\033[0m',
logging.WARNING: '\033[1;33mWARNING\033[0m',
logging.INFO: '\033[1;32mINFO\033[0m',
logging.DEBUG: '\033[1;35mDEBUG\033[0m',
}
def format(self, record):
'''
Depending on the level, change the formatting.
'''
self._fmt = self.FORMATS.get(record.levelno, record.levelno) + ':%(name)s:%(funcName)s:%(lineno)s|%(message)s'
self._style = logging.PercentStyle(self._fmt)
return logging.Formatter.format(self, record)
### Setup ###
formatter = KiiFormatter()
handler = logging.StreamHandler(sys.stdout)
handler.setFormatter(formatter)
logging.root.addHandler(handler)
logging.root.setLevel(logging.DEBUG)
### Call Override ###
def _get_message(record):
'''
Replacement for logging.LogRecord.getMessage that uses the new-style string formatting
for it's messages.
'''
msg = str(record.msg)
args = record.args
if args:
if not isinstance(args, tuple):
args = (args,)
msg = msg.format(*args)
return msg
def _handle_wrap(fcn):
'''
Wrap the handle function to replace the passed in record's getMessage function before
calling handle.
'''
@functools.wraps(fcn)
def handle(record):
record.getMessage = types.MethodType(_get_message, record)
return fcn(record)
return handle
def get_logger(name=None):
'''
Get a logger instance that uses new-style string formatting
'''
log = logging.getLogger(name)
if not hasattr(log, "_newstyle"):
log.handle = _handle_wrap(log.handle)
log._newstyle = True
return log
